Quick Answer: How to shotgun a beer: Hold a cold 12 oz can horizontally, puncture a hole near the bottom seam using a key or knife, rotate the can upright, place your mouth over the hole, then crack open the top tab. The pressure release lets the beer drain in 3-5 seconds.

To shotgun a beer, you puncture a hole near the bottom of a 12 oz aluminum can, seal your mouth over the opening, pop the top tab, and let atmospheric pressure force the beer down your throat in roughly 3 to 5 seconds.

The technique bypasses the narrow can opening, allowing continuous airflow so the liquid drains without glugging.

Popularized in American college tailgates and dorm rooms since the 1970s, shotgunning works best with light lagers between 4% and 5% ABV served at 38°F, since cold, low-carbonation beer produces less foam.

Below, we cover the exact tools, hole placement, body posture, and safety considerations that separate a clean 4-second shotgun from a shirt-soaking mess.

Common Mistakes and Myths

After watching hundreds of first-timers attempt this at tailgates and backyard parties, the same errors surface repeatedly. Most failures trace back to hole placement, can angle, or believing physics-defying claims that circulate on social media.

The Most Common Physical Mistakes

  • Punching the hole too low: A hole in the middle of the can drains slower because beer floods the opening before air can enter. Position it 0.5–1 inch from the bottom rim.
  • Making the hole too small: A pinhole from a car key takes 8–12 seconds to drain. A dime-sized opening (roughly 18mm) drains a 12 oz can in 3–5 seconds.
  • Forgetting to tilt: Holding the can vertical creates a vacuum lock. Tilting 30–45 degrees so the hole sits above the tab lets air replace liquid smoothly.
  • Opening the tab first: Break the seal only after your mouth is sealed on the hole, or you’ll lose 2–3 oz of foam immediately.

Frequently Asked Questions

Does shotgunning a beer actually get you drunk faster?

Yes—chugging 12 oz in 3-5 seconds delivers alcohol to your stomach far faster than sipping, so blood alcohol concentration (BAC) rises more sharply within 15-30 minutes.

The carbonation and rapid intake can also accelerate absorption, which is why binge-drinking guidelines (4+ drinks for women, 5+ for men in 2 hours per NIAAA) apply here.

What’s the best beer to shotgun for beginners?

Stick with light American lagers around 4.2% ABV like Coors Light, Bud Light, or Miller Lite—they’re less carbonated than craft beers and easier to drink cold and fast.

Avoid IPAs, stouts, or anything above 6% ABV, since higher hop content and heavier bodies cause gagging and foam blowback.

Where exactly should I puncture the can?

Pierce the lower side of the can about 1 inch from the bottom, on the opposite side from the pull tab, holding the can horizontally.

This spot lets air rush in through the top tab once opened, creating the vacuum-break that makes beer flow out in roughly 3 seconds instead of 15.

Why does beer foam explode everywhere when I shotgun?

Foam eruptions happen when the can is warm (above 45°F), shaken, or punctured with a jagged hole that agitates dissolved CO2.

Chill cans to 34-38°F for at least 2 hours, use a clean key or knife for a smooth hole, and open the top tab only after your mouth is sealed on the puncture.

Is shotgunning beer safe for your teeth or throat?

The main risks are cutting your lip or tongue on the aluminum edge and aspirating beer into your lungs if you cough mid-chug.

Smooth the puncture hole with your thumb, keep the can angled so beer flows down—not up your nose—and never shotgun while lying down or if you’ve already had several drinks.
